In a message dated 2/1/01 5:02:56 AM, Garrett writes:
<< They told me that unlike a hard dinghy, a RIB has a relatively short life
expectancy, particularly in very sunny climes, unless it is has been kept
under cover and well-maintained. However, it has lots of advantages, too.
>>
Keep it away from mice and other small rodents too. Mice are not put off by
the taste of hypalon and see the dinghy as a convenient source of fabric for
their nests. Unfortunately the all hazards guarantee does not cover mouse
attacks. Don't ask how I know this.
